as I have just bought an Hyundai Ioniq 5 based on the EGMP platform which seems to be prone to failures of the ICCU (Integrated Charging Control Unit) I'm very interested what you think about options to reduce the probability of getting affected by this.

The issue seems to be to high inrush current when the charging of the 12V battery is initiated. (https://static.nhtsa.gov/odi/rcl/2024/RCMN-24V868-9385.pdf)
The fix seems to be to gradually ramp up power when initiating a charge cycle of the 12V battery. (Software only fix)

Now I'm wondering how I could minimize the inrush current in other ways.

I was thinking that maybe replacing the 12V battery with a LiFePo4 battery with a good BMS which limits the inrush current. But that currently is only speculation as I can't find specs for inrush currents on these batteries.

What do you think?
Any other ideas to limit the charging inrush current of the 12V battery?

Sure I‘m totally aware of voiding warranty if I change anything.

To clarify as some replies suggest it was not completely clear:
The problem does not have to do anything with charging the cars high voltage battery. The problem seems to stem from the car trying to charge the old school 12V battery which upon charger activation shortly takes a really huge inrush current.

The software fix via ramping the voltage already seems like a good approach but you still hear about some failures with updated ICCUs. I’m also well aware that the problem is to some extent overhyped otherwise I would not have bought the car.
I work in automotive software and know for a fact that if a manufacturer can do a recall with software only he will always do it, even if a physical solution would only cost 5ct per customer.

I was just thinking what kind of options I would have to limit the current with easy reversible measures like a different battery. (Which also would be hard to trace if we are talking warranty but let's not go there and focus on the technical aspects instead)
